Alleging step motherly treatment, to various wards in Kharar in terms of development projects, Congress MLA from Kharar Jagmohan Singh Kang held a protest and blocked traffic.

The dharna that was led by Kang was organised by the Congress on the Kharar-Chandigarh national highway, gave an ultimatum of one month to stop step motherly treatment to some wards of Kharar city by the municipal council.

Kang threatened to gherao the residence of chief minister Parkash Singh Badal in Chandigarh.
He said, “Punjab Congress would raise the issue of non-development in Kharar and rampant corruption in the municipal council in the Punjab Vidhan Sabha during the ensuing budget session,” while addressing the protestors.

Before blocking the road a protest march was held in Kharar and a dharna was staged at the MC office.

The traffic on the Kharar-Chandigarh highway was blocked for about 30 minutes.
Kang said, “The council is not responding to the request of undertaking development works.

The state of roads is bad but no one is paying heed. During the recent visit of union railways minister Pawan Kumar Bansal, MC had failed to respond to his request for repairing the road.”
